What is a dual fuel slide in range and how does it work?
A dual fuel slide in range is a type of cooking range that combines the benefits of gas and electric cooking. It typically features a gas cooktop and an electric oven, allowing you to enjoy the precision and control of gas cooking on the stovetop, while also benefiting from the even heat and convenience of electric cooking in the oven. This combination provides a versatile and efficient cooking experience, making it a popular choice among home cooks and professional chefs alike.
The way it works is quite straightforward. The gas cooktop uses natural gas or propane to fuel the burners, providing a consistent and adjustable flame for cooking on the stovetop. The electric oven, on the other hand, uses electricity to heat the oven cavity, providing a precise and even temperature for baking, roasting, and broiling. By combining these two cooking methods, a dual fuel slide in range offers the best of both worlds, allowing you to cook with the technique and flair of a gas range, while also enjoying the convenience and consistency of electric cooking.

How do I install a dual fuel slide in range in my kitchen?
Installing a dual fuel slide in range in your kitchen can be a bit more complicated than installing a standard electric range, but it’s still a relatively straightforward process. The first thing to consider is the type of fuel connection you need, such as a natural gas line or a propane tank. You’ll also need to ensure that your kitchen is equipped with a suitable electrical connection, such as a 240-volt outlet. Once you’ve got the necessary connections in place, you can start to think about the installation process itself.
The installation process typically involves sliding the range into place and connecting the fuel and electrical lines. You may need to hire a professional installer to do this, especially if you’re not comfortable with gas and electrical connections. However, many dual fuel slide in ranges come with easy-to-follow installation instructions, and some manufacturers even offer installation services as part of the purchase package. Regardless of who does the installation, it’s essential to ensure that the range is properly connected and vented to avoid any safety hazards or performance issues.

What are the safety precautions I should take when using a dual fuel slide in range?
When using a dual fuel slide in range, there are several safety precautions you should take to avoid any accidents or injuries. The first thing to consider is the gas connection, which should be checked regularly to ensure it’s secure and not leaking. You should also ensure that the range is properly vented, using a range hood or exhaust fan to remove any combustion byproducts and cooking fumes from the kitchen. You should also keep a fire extinguisher in the kitchen, just in case.
In addition to these general safety precautions, you should also take some specific precautions when cooking with a dual fuel slide in range. For example, you should never leave the range unattended when it’s in use, and you should keep a close eye on any children or pets who may be in the kitchen. You should also ensure that the range is installed and maintained properly, following the manufacturer’s instructions and guidelines. By taking these simple safety precautions, you can enjoy a safe and enjoyable cooking experience with your dual fuel slide in range.
